Watery stool
Hello, After 21/2 months vaccination, my baby (now 3 months) was prescribed iron (0.4ml). After consuming it for 2 days, baby started pooping blood. Unsure of what’s causing the issue, we did a stool, urine & blood test. The doctor said it could be lactose intolerance and advised to start Nutramigen. This formula is very difficult to find in the market and we haven’t started giving the baby yet. However, we stopped iron and started 5 days of probiotic. Now, the stool is mustard yellow and there’s no blood. I don’t know if stopping iron did the work or taking probiotics. However, now my concern is her stool is watery. Any advice?
